Mid-Space-Independent and IDIR Deformable Image Registration

2D and 3D deformable image registration using the mid-space-independent (MSI) and intermediate deformable image registration (IDIR) methods.

These are codes for 2D and 3D deformable image registration, using the mid-space-independent (MSI; Aganj et al, NeuroImage 2017) and the intermediate deformable image registration (IDIR; Aganj & Fischl, ISBI 2023) approaches.
See EXAMPLE_MSI.m and EXAMPLE_IDIR.m for short tutorials. If available, GPUs can be used to speed up the registration.

I. Aganj, J. E. Iglesias, M. Reuter, M. R. Sabuncu, and B. Fischl, "Mid-space-independent deformable image registration," NeuroImage, vol. 152, pp. 158-170, 2017. http://doi.org/10.1016/j.neuroimage.2017.02.055

I. Aganj and B. Fischl, "Intermediate deformable image registration via windowed cross-correlation," in Proc. IEEE International Symposium on Biomedical Imaging, pp. 1-5, Cartagena de Indias, Colombia, 2023.
